Founded in 1893, American University is a private four-year research university that is known for its strong programs in international affairs, law, and communication. It is located on an 84-acre carbon-neutral designated campus in northwest Washington, D.C.
Founded in 1864, Gallaudet University is a private liberal arts university that is known for its dedication to providing education for deaf and hard-of-hearing students, and its strong programs in deaf studies and education. It is located on a 99-acre campus in Washington, D.C.
Founded in 1789, Georgetown University is a private nonprofit Catholic university that is known for its strong programs in International Affairs, Business, and Law. It is located on a 110-acre campus in Washington, District of Columbia.
Founded in 1867, Howard University is a private four-year Historically Black research university that is known for its strong programs in Law, Medicine, and Engineering. It is located on an 89-acre campus in Washington, District of Columbia.
Founded in 1975, the National Conservatory of Dramatic Arts is a private nonprofit college that focuses on providing intensive training for aspiring actors and theatre professionals. It is located on a commuter campus in Washington, D.C., in historic Georgetown.
The National Intelligence University is a public four-year university that is known for its programs in Intelligence Studies, National Security, and Cyber Security. It is located on a campus in Washington, District of Columbia.
Founded in 1887, The Catholic University of America is a private four-year Catholic research university that is known for its strong programs in theology, law, and the arts and sciences. It is located on a 184-acre campus just north of Capitol Hill in Washington, D.C.
Founded in 1897, Trinity Washington University is a private four-year Catholic liberal arts university that is known for its focus on women's leadership and its strong programs in the arts and sciences. It is located on a 26-acre campus in Washington, District of Columbia—three miles north of downtown.
Founded in 1976, the University of the District of Columbia is a public university that is known for its strong programs in Education, Business, and the Arts. It is located on a 26-acre campus in Washington, District of Columbia.
